Advertise N15 billion Debt Against KEPCO Energy–Court Ask UBA

Federal High Court sitting in Abuja, the Federal capital territory of Nigeria  has directed United Bank for Africa Plc UBA to make public the winding up petition filed against a limited liability company KEPCO ENERGY RESOURCES  NIGERIA LIMITED (RC 6900064) over the inability of the company to pay a debt of N15,221,674,976.4.

UBA Hinges Future Performance On Cost Efficiency, Improved Asset Quality

Pan African financial institution, United Bank for Africa (UBA) Plc has assured its local and international investors that it’s prudent focus on improved asset quality as well as the continuous adoption of strict cost efficient measures will help the bank achieve its objectives and priorities for the 2019 financial year and beyond.
